SQL injection vulnerability in example.php in SAXON 5.4 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the template parameter.
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in admin/menu.php in SAXON 5.4 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the config[news_url] parameter.
SAXON 5.4, with display_errors enabled, all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information via (1) a direct request for news.php, (2) an invalid use of a newsid array parameter to admin/edit-item.php, and possibly unspecified vectors related to additional scripts in (3) admin/, (4) rss/, and (5) the root directory of the installation, which reveal the path in various error messages.
